Earlier this month, Zigazoo conducted a survey among its child users asking for their opinions on the issue. Notably, 43% of Zigazoo users said they had already been bullied online, and more than 50% cited TikTok as a social media app they “should stay away from” It was by far the most popular among media apps.

Here are the core values ​​that Zigazoo promotes throughout the month:

● Authenticated users only: Ensures security and parental consent, and ensures peer-to-peer only interaction. No adults, no bots, no deepfakes.

● Positive interactions only: Use research-based product design that fosters only positive, trust-building experiences for all users. We do not encourage or allow bullying or negativity.

● Content moderation: Protect children from harmful content and negative sentiment. Human moderation, not censorship, adjusts for developmental appropriateness while maintaining diverse perspectives.

● Ethical algorithms: Like physical communities, content algorithms prey on our worst instincts and are not designed to participate at all costs, making celebrities the most destructive figures in society. We guarantee that our hard-earned reputation is built on.

● Balanced screen time: Set digital boundaries to encourage off-screen activities such as physical activity, real-life social experiences, and breaks.
